Originally posted by silverstoneTT
How hard is it to wire the Z4 lights to the turn signal blinkers? I want to get them but I dont want to end up having to take the car somewhere to do that and have them charge me more than the lights themselves to get them in.

They are very easy to install, basically the installation steps are;

(1) Remove your OEM "Z" emblem
(2) Remove "Z" emblem back side OEM double tape residual and clean back of the emblem with alcohol
(3) Clean the fender where the Z4 LED marker will go with wax remover then clean it with alcohol (very important step for good Z4 marker double tape & fender adhesion)
(4) Wire the 2 wires from the Z4 LED marker to either parking or signal light wires
(5) Turn ON either parking light or signal light to test for proper wiring
(6) Remove the under side double tape backing from the Z4 LED marker
(7) Stick the Z4 LED marker to the fender
(8) Remove the top side double tape backing from the Z4 LED marker
(9) Stick the OEM "Z" emblem to the Z4 LED marker (top side)
(10) Wax the surrounding (fender) of the Z4 maker (due to application of wax remover and alcohol)
(11) Repeat Steps (1)~(10) for the other side
(12) Wash your hands then enjoy the show

Originally posted by vics350
Hey Andy, would you happen to have a picture of the amber front concept LED reflector without being turned on?

I am wondering how it would look during the daytime. Are the bulb housings clear with amber bulbs inside or are the bulbs clear and then turn amber when turned on?
We ONLY use "clear" LEDs for our front concept reflectors. They look clear when OFF and look either amber, blue, or white when ON.
